Parents

Parents play a crucial part in supporting the involvement of their children with football.

The FA aims to help parents play a positive role, recognising that involement in football can greatly influence the development of children, both in the football envirnment and in their overall lifestyles.

The FA has launched a new free Respect online parent guide - a replacement for Soccer Parent. This provides a great introduction in how adults should behave to support children in the game.

The online module features content to showcase unacceptable parental behaviour and its consequences on young players with commentary from well-known and grassroots football figures, including Stuart Pearce and Howard Webb.

The course is FREE and all you have to do is register with FA Learning to gain access so why not get online and get involved today.

The course offers practical advice, hints and tips on what it takes to be a supportive soccer parent and how to positively influence young players.

As well as being designed to be informative, fun and engaging, one of the key aspects of the module is that coaches are given advice to assist in gaining positive contributions from parents as well as understanding issues on specific areas such as child welfare and attitudes.
